Incident/Accident records
Question: I landed at a controlled airport without clearance due to a full electrical failure, flight control failure. It was investigated by the FAA and they told me that I am not responsible as I did what I had to do and it was more of a maintainence issue. I am worried this may come up in an interview. If that was put in as an incident, would I already know? It happended in April. I filled out an ASAP too. I asked the FAA guy investigating and he said no incident but I am uncertain.

Email [email protected] and request a copy of your accident / incident / enforcement record (under the Freedom of Information Act). They'll need your full name, mailing address, and of course a return email. If it says you're clean, you're clean.
